Florida Added 17,500 Private Sector Jobs In March, According To ADP Regional Employment Report®ROSELAND, N.J., April 11, 2018 /PRNewswire/ -- The State of Florida added 17,500 private sector jobs during the month of March, according to the ADP Regional Employment Report which is produced by ADP®, a leading global provider of Human Capital Management (HCM) solutions, in collaboration with Moody's Analytics, Inc. Broadly distributed to the public each month, free of charge, the ADP Regional Employment Report measures the change in regional and state nonfarm private employment each month on a seasonally adjusted basis.
